My mother was a resident from 2001-2003 & my father has been on the Mezzanine unit since April 2011. She did, & he is receiving excellent care. It is true that staffing, activities & resources have changed over the years, but healthcare has changed everywhere, not just at this facility. The nurses & CNAs are wonderful, kind & caring. Sure they're short-staffed a lot but unfortunately "nursing" & "being short" isn't unique to Cabrini, it's in every acute & long-term facility. The managers are very conscientious, the LPN's are knowledgeable & the CNA's are dedicated. The NP's are fabulous! I really can't say that anyone is there just for the paycheck. To be a nurse, you have to love it because it is very tough to have the stamina & patience to deal with residents, families, doctors, staffing issues, other ancillary departments. The nurses do work extremely hard, many residents require "total care." Bottom line is nursing does it all & the Cabrini nurses do their best. Once upon a time a nursing supervisor told her staff.... " We are nurses, the difficult we take care of immediately, the impossible takes us little longer." Nurses are human too, we make mistakes, accidents happen. The most important thing to focus on is that your family member is clean, nourished, & safe. I am an RN in a very busy ER in the Bronx @ we are always short. That's just the reality of healthcare. I always recommend SCNH to family members of my patients. I consider myself a "cheerleader for Cabrini." People due take note especially when I mention my parents & my experiences. Sure, there have been some issues, but every place has it's glitches. I'd love the patient to nurse ratio to be 2:1 but that's not going to happen. I agree, the food isn't gourmet fare, the housekeeping isn't spectacular, belongings get lost or broken, it's annoying, aggravating & frustrating but this is all synonymous with "institutional living." The only place that's perfect is Heaven. Thank you

This facility has gone DOWNHILL in the last 2 years! The place is absolutely filthy EXCEPT for the Lobby & the Administration area. The only patient care unit that is spic & span is One West. Why? Because One West is the short-term (21 day stay) Rehab Unit that sparkles because it's the unit that entices patient & family into considering long-term placement. Well if you do choose to place your loved one there, the " honeymoon" ends on day 22. This is supposed to be a skilled nursing facility (SNF)...... What a joke.... There's not one skilled nurse in this facility. The Director of Nursing sits in her office, dressed to kill, never, ever makes rounds to see what's going on in the patient care areas. If you go into the office to discuss an issue or to complain, she looks at you with this blank stare & just placates you until you are blue in the face & DOES ABSOLUTELY NOTHING! The nursing supervisors don't supervise. They too have blank stares when confronted or questioned by family members. The administrator is just as bad, the only time she's visible is @ lunchtime when she's having lunch in the café. I feel sorry for the nurse aides because they work like dogs. They units are always short-staffed especially on weekends & holidays & it's not because of sick calls, it's because only 4 aides are scheduled for 40+ residents, ie 10-11 residents to one aide. Two LPNs are assigned to medicate, do dressing changes, etc. to cover 2 patient care area, ie 90 patients!!!!!! The units are filthy, one porter per unit to mop 40+ rooms, dining area, TV rooms, dump garbage, clean bathrooms.. Absolutely disgusting! There's a ward secretary who is assigned occasionally to answer phones, arrange transportation, take care of charts, MD orders, etc. This place has turned into a filthy, dump. An absolute disgrace!!!!! Mother Cabrini is probably turning in her grave!
